I take a while to warm up before getting into it, sometime it can take me a couple of hours.
In that time I just sit and watch, grab a coffee and if I suddenly exclaim ..."bugga, I missed that", its about then I pick up the camera and put down the coffee and not come up for air again until the sun goes down.
Its funny but in the time prior I see nothing picture worthy and its not related to the hour of day or day of the week.
Pick a nice spot to sit, maybe even somewhere on the street with a coffee. Bring your camera but just sit and watch. You can photograph from this location but its not going to be ideal as you really need to be on your feet, so just watch as scenes open up before your eyes. You might think that the first opportunity is a pic, but is it …is your third eye working or are you being impatient and just want to take a pic. Is a picture of someone reading a book interesting, think about it as a photo. What was it that made it worthwhile as a picture, maybe it wasn’t. Another way to start your motor might be to visit a location popular with buskers or street performers. Fill your pockets with some coins and you can pay for the privilege. Shift angles, take notice of your surroundings, look at the light and shadows …what do you want your photo to say.
